A Comprehensive Guide to Writing a Freelance Contract – Essential Tips and Step-by-Step Instructions

Essential Tips for Writing a Freelance Contract A Step-by-Step Guide

As a freelancer, it’s crucial to protect yourself and your work by having a solid contract in place. A well-written contract not only outlines the scope of the project but also sets clear expectations for both parties involved. Whether you’re a seasoned freelancer or just starting out, this step-by-step guide will help you create a freelance contract that covers all the essential aspects.

1. Define the Scope of Work: Clearly define the project’s scope, including the deliverables, deadlines, and any specific requirements. This section should leave no room for ambiguity and ensure that both you and your client are on the same page.

2. Specify Payment Terms: Outline the payment terms, including the total project cost, payment schedule, and any additional fees or expenses. Be clear about when and how you expect to be paid to avoid any misunderstandings or payment delays.

3. Include Intellectual Property Rights: Clearly state who will own the intellectual property rights to the work once it’s completed. If you want to retain ownership or have specific licensing terms, make sure to include them in the contract.

4. Set Terms for Revisions and Changes: Establish how revisions and changes to the project will be handled. Specify the number of revisions included in the project cost and outline any additional charges for extra revisions or major changes.

5. Address Confidentiality and Non-Disclosure: If the project involves sensitive information or trade secrets, include a confidentiality clause to protect both parties. Clearly define what information is considered confidential and outline the consequences of breaching the agreement.

6. Include Termination and Dispute Resolution Clauses: Outline the conditions under which either party can terminate the contract and the process for resolving any disputes that may arise. This will help protect your interests and provide a clear path forward in case of any disagreements.

By following these essential tips and including all the necessary clauses, you can create a freelance contract that protects your rights, sets clear expectations, and ensures a smooth working relationship with your clients. Remember, a well-written contract is the foundation of a successful freelance career.

Understanding the Basics

Before diving into the details of writing a freelance contract, it is important to understand the basics. A freelance contract is a legally binding agreement between a freelancer and a client that outlines the terms and conditions of their working relationship. It serves as a protection for both parties and ensures that everyone is on the same page.

When entering into a freelance contract, it is crucial to have a clear understanding of the project requirements, expectations, and deliverables. This includes defining the scope of work, setting clear deadlines, and determining the payment terms.

The scope of work refers to the specific tasks and responsibilities that the freelancer will be responsible for. It is important to clearly define what is included in the project and what is not. This helps to avoid any misunderstandings or disputes down the line.

Setting clear deadlines is essential to ensure that the project stays on track and is completed in a timely manner. Both the freelancer and the client should agree on realistic deadlines for each milestone or deliverable. This helps to manage expectations and avoid any delays or misunderstandings.

Determining the payment terms is another important aspect of a freelance contract. This includes specifying the payment amount, the method of payment, and the payment schedule. It is important to be clear about when and how the freelancer will be paid to avoid any payment disputes.

By understanding these basics, freelancers can create a solid foundation for their freelance contracts. This ensures that both parties are clear on the project requirements, deadlines, and payment terms, leading to a successful working relationship.

Define the Scope of Work

Defining the scope of work is a crucial step in creating a freelance contract. It sets clear expectations for both the freelancer and the client, ensuring that everyone is on the same page regarding the project’s objectives and deliverables.

To define the scope of work, start by outlining the specific tasks and responsibilities that the freelancer will be responsible for. This can include the type of work to be done, such as writing articles or designing a website, as well as any specific requirements or guidelines that need to be followed.

It’s important to be as detailed as possible when defining the scope of work. This helps to avoid any misunderstandings or disagreements later on. Include specific deliverables that the freelancer is expected to provide, such as a certain number of articles or a completed website design.

Additionally, consider including any limitations or exclusions in the scope of work. This can help to clarify what is not included in the project and prevent any potential scope creep. For example, if the freelancer is responsible for designing a website, specify that any coding or backend development is not included in their scope of work.

Finally, it’s a good idea to include a timeline or schedule for the project within the scope of work. This can help to ensure that both parties are aware of the expected timeline and can plan accordingly. Include any key milestones or deadlines that need to be met, as well as any dependencies or dependencies on other tasks.

By clearly defining the scope of work in your freelance contract, you can set the foundation for a successful project. It helps to manage expectations, avoid misunderstandings, and ensure that both the freelancer and the client are on the same page throughout the duration of the project.

Set Clear Deadlines

Setting clear deadlines is crucial when writing a freelance contract. Deadlines ensure that both parties are aware of the timeline for completing the project and help to avoid any misunderstandings or delays.

When setting deadlines, it is important to be realistic and consider the scope of work involved. Break down the project into smaller tasks or milestones and assign specific deadlines to each of them. This will help to keep the project on track and ensure that progress is being made.

It is also important to communicate the consequences of missing deadlines in the contract. This can include penalties or adjustments to the payment terms. By clearly outlining the repercussions of missed deadlines, both parties are motivated to meet the agreed-upon timeline.

Additionally, it is beneficial to include a clause in the contract that allows for adjustments to the deadlines if unforeseen circumstances arise. This can help to accommodate any unexpected delays or changes in the project scope.

Overall, setting clear deadlines in a freelance contract is essential for ensuring a smooth and successful project. It helps to keep both parties accountable and provides a clear roadmap for completing the work on time.

Determine the Payment Terms

When it comes to freelance contracts, one of the most important aspects to consider is the payment terms. Clearly defining how and when you will be paid is crucial for both parties involved in the agreement. Here are some essential tips to help you determine the payment terms:

1. Payment Method: Specify the preferred payment method, whether it’s through bank transfer, PayPal, or any other secure payment platform. Make sure to provide all the necessary details, such as account numbers or email addresses, to avoid any confusion or delays in the payment process.

2. Payment Schedule: Clearly outline the payment schedule, including the frequency and dates when payments are due. This will help both you and your client stay organized and ensure that payments are made on time. For example, you can specify that invoices should be paid within 30 days of receipt.

3. Late Payment Policy: It’s important to address the issue of late payments in your contract. Specify the consequences of late payments, such as late fees or interest charges, to encourage your client to make timely payments. This will help protect your interests and ensure that you are compensated for your work.

4. Currency and Taxes: Clearly state the currency in which you expect to be paid. If you work with international clients, consider any potential currency conversion fees or exchange rate fluctuations. Additionally, clarify whether your fees include taxes or if they will be added on top of the agreed-upon amount.

5. Payment Terms for Milestones: If your project involves multiple milestones or phases, specify the payment terms for each milestone. This can include the percentage of the total fee that will be paid upon completion of each milestone or any specific deliverables that need to be met before payment is made.

6. Payment Disputes: It’s always a good idea to include a clause in your contract that addresses payment disputes. Outline the steps that will be taken to resolve any payment-related issues, such as mediation or arbitration. This will help protect both parties and provide a clear process for resolving conflicts.

By clearly defining the payment terms in your freelance contract, you can establish a solid foundation for your working relationship with your client. This will help ensure that both parties are on the same page and can avoid any misunderstandings or disputes in the future.

Crafting the Contract

When it comes to crafting a freelance contract, there are several key elements that you need to include to ensure that both parties are protected and clear on the terms of the agreement.

First and foremost, it is important to clearly state the names and contact information of both the freelancer and the client. This will make it easy to identify who the contract is between and how to reach each party.

Next, you should outline the scope of work in detail. This includes a clear description of the project or tasks that the freelancer will be responsible for. Be as specific as possible to avoid any confusion or misunderstandings later on.

Setting clear deadlines is also crucial. Specify the dates by which certain milestones or deliverables should be completed. This will help both parties stay on track and ensure that the project is completed in a timely manner.

Payment terms should also be clearly defined in the contract. Specify the amount of compensation the freelancer will receive, as well as the method and frequency of payment. It is important to be clear about any additional expenses or fees that may be incurred.

In addition to these key elements, it is also a good idea to include any additional terms or conditions that are relevant to the specific project. This could include things like confidentiality agreements, intellectual property rights, or dispute resolution processes.

Finally, both parties should review and sign the contract to indicate their agreement and acceptance of the terms. This will provide a legal record of the agreement and protect both parties in the event of any disputes or misunderstandings.

By carefully crafting a freelance contract that includes all of these elements, you can ensure that both parties are on the same page and that the project runs smoothly from start to finish.

Include Detailed Project Description

When writing a freelance contract, it is crucial to include a detailed project description. This section should clearly outline the scope of the project, the specific tasks that need to be completed, and any other relevant details.

The project description should provide a clear understanding of what the client expects from the freelancer. It should include information about the goals and objectives of the project, as well as any specific requirements or preferences.

By including a detailed project description in the contract, both parties can ensure that they are on the same page and have a clear understanding of what needs to be done. This can help prevent any misunderstandings or disputes down the line.

When writing the project description, it is important to be as specific as possible. Use clear and concise language to describe the project and avoid any ambiguous or vague terms. This will help avoid any confusion and ensure that both parties are clear about the expectations.

Additionally, it can be helpful to include a timeline or schedule in the project description. This can outline the key milestones or deadlines for the project, allowing both parties to have a clear understanding of the timeline and what needs to be accomplished at each stage.

Overall, including a detailed project description in the freelance contract is essential for setting clear expectations and ensuring that both parties are on the same page. It provides a roadmap for the project and helps prevent any misunderstandings or disputes. By taking the time to craft a thorough project description, freelancers can set themselves up for success and establish a strong foundation for their working relationship with the client.

Specify Deliverables and Milestones

When writing a freelance contract, it is crucial to clearly specify the deliverables and milestones of the project. This section of the contract outlines the specific tasks or products that the freelancer is expected to deliver to the client.

Deliverables:

Clearly define what the freelancer is responsible for delivering. This could include completed articles, design mockups, software code, or any other tangible or intangible work product. Be as specific as possible to avoid any confusion or misunderstandings.

Milestones:

Break down the project into smaller milestones or stages. Each milestone should represent a significant step towards completing the overall project. For example, if the project is to develop a website, the milestones could include designing the homepage, coding the backend functionality, and testing the website for bugs.

By including milestones in the contract, both the freelancer and the client have a clear understanding of the project’s progress and can track it effectively. It also allows for better project management and ensures that the freelancer is meeting the client’s expectations.

Timeline:

In addition to specifying the deliverables and milestones, it is essential to include a timeline for completing each milestone and the overall project. This timeline should be realistic and take into account any potential delays or unforeseen circumstances.

For example:

– Milestone 1: Design homepage – Due date: [insert date]

– Milestone 2: Code backend functionality – Due date: [insert date]

– Milestone 3: Test website for bugs – Due date: [insert date]

– Overall project completion – Due date: [insert date]

By setting clear deadlines for each milestone, the freelancer and the client can stay on track and ensure that the project is completed within the agreed-upon timeframe.

Remember, the more detailed and specific the deliverables and milestones are in the contract, the less room there is for misunderstandings or disputes. It is essential to have a clear and comprehensive contract to protect both parties involved in the freelance project.

Question-answer:

What is a freelance contract?

A freelance contract is a legally binding agreement between a freelancer and a client that outlines the terms and conditions of their working relationship.

Why is it important to have a freelance contract?

Having a freelance contract is important because it helps protect both the freelancer and the client by clearly defining the scope of work, payment terms, and other important details.

What should be included in a freelance contract?

A freelance contract should include the names and contact information of both parties, a description of the work to be done, the payment terms, deadlines, and any other relevant details such as confidentiality clauses or intellectual property rights.

How can I ensure that my freelance contract is legally binding?

To ensure that your freelance contract is legally binding, it is recommended to consult with a lawyer who specializes in contract law. They can help you draft a contract that complies with the laws in your jurisdiction and protects your rights.

What should I do if a client refuses to sign a freelance contract?

If a client refuses to sign a freelance contract, it is generally best to walk away from the project. Working without a contract puts you at risk of not getting paid or facing other issues down the line. It’s important to prioritize your own protection and find clients who are willing to sign a contract.

What is a freelance contract?

A freelance contract is a legally binding agreement between a freelancer and a client that outlines the terms and conditions of their working relationship. It includes details such as project scope, payment terms, deadlines, and intellectual property rights.

Like this post? Please share to your friends:
Luke and Associates-Law Firm Botswana
Leave a Reply

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: